Comparing Typical Antivirus Software and PC Matic
Antivirus software is an essential layer of defense for personal and business computers, helping protect users against malware, ransomware, spyware, and phishing attempts. Traditional antivirus (AV) solutions—such as Norton, McAfee, Bitdefender, or Kaspersky—have long been recognized for providing real-time scanning, heuristic analysis, and frequent signature updates. In contrast, PC Matic takes a somewhat unconventional approach by emphasizing "whitelisting" and system optimization in addition to malware prevention. Both models have significant strengths and noticeable trade-offs.

Pros of a Typical Antivirus Application
Most conventional antivirus programs rely on large threat databases of known malware signatures. This approach allows for quick detection of widely distributed viruses and provides familiarity for most users. Leading AV suites also include heuristic detection, which identifies suspicious behavior even before a virus signature is available. Many offer cloud-based analysis, meaning threats are detected faster across all users.

Another major advantage is usability. Traditional antivirus applications come with polished interfaces, one-click scans, and strong compatibility with Windows, macOS, and Android systems. Users can often get layered protection features like firewalls, password managers, and VPNs in a single package. They integrate seamlessly with most software environments without requiring significant attention from the user.

Cons of a Typical Antivirus Application
Despite these benefits, traditional AV tools have weaknesses. Because they rely heavily on constantly updated signature databases, they can be vulnerable to "zero-day" attacks—threats that exploit unknown vulnerabilities before detection systems catch up. They also tend to run in the background constantly, consuming memory and CPU resources, which can slow performance, especially on older computers.

Furthermore, many antivirus vendors have shifted to subscription-based models, which can be expensive over time. Some users criticize these products for aggressive marketing or unnecessary bundled features that complicate the user experience.

Pros of PC Matic
PC Matic differentiates itself through a whitelisting approach, meaning it only allows pre-approved, tested applications to run. This design blocks unknown software—potentially including all new malware—before it can execute, making it very resistant to zero-day attacks. The program emphasizes automation, system optimization, and maintenance, combining antivirus protection with tools for improving speed, reducing junk files, and managing updates.

Another advantage of PC Matic is that it's an American-made product that prides itself on transparency and domestic support. It's a single purchase that covers multiple devices, rather than the common annual subscription model, which appeals to users seeking long-term cost stability.

Cons of PC Matic
However, PC Matic's whitelisting strategy can be a double-edged sword. Since it blocks unknown programs by default, legitimate new software may initially be flagged, causing frustration or workflow interruptions. Users need to manually approve or trust certain applications, which can feel cumbersome for less tech-savvy individuals, but is more secure.

Performance optimization features, though helpful, sometimes overlap with native Windows maintenance tools, offering limited added benefit. Additionally, PC Matic's user interface and usability have occasionally faced criticism for being less intuitive than mainstream antivirus software.

Summary
In summary, traditional antivirus applications excel at user friendliness and well-rounded protection but can struggle against rapidly evolving threats and recurring costs. PC Matic, conversely, provides robust prevention through whitelisting and strong value with its flat-rate pricing, though it demands more user intervention and adjustment. Choosing between them depends on whether a user prioritizes simplicity and convenience or proactive and airtight security at the potential cost of flexibility.
